  • #41 Inside Murphy Pipelines: Building HDPE Projects Through Education & Execution
    Apr 1 2026

    "We sat down with Bill Fussner of Murphy Pipelines to discuss how education and execution are driving HDPE growth across the country. With a background in pipeline rehab and engineering, Bill focuses on working with utilities and engineers early to position HDPE and trenchless methods as long-term solutions.

    Murphy’s core strength is trenchless installation, specifically CompressionFit, sliplining and pipe bursting. These methods allow the installation of fully fused, leak-free HDPE systems with minimal disruption and significantly lower impact than open-cut methods in complex corridors.

    The takeaway: aging infrastructure continues to fail, and HDPE paired with trenchless methods offers a more durable, scalable path forward."

  • #40 Pipes Built for Data Centers: HDPE and PPR-CT
    Jan 30 2026

    Data centers are reshaping infrastructure design, particularly for cooling systems and underground utilities. In this episode of the Poly Podcast, we sit down with Andy McElroy of McElroy Manufacturing to discuss why HDPE and PPR-CT are increasingly specified for this rapidly expanding market.

    The conversation examines how hyperscalers evaluate piping systems through performance, constructibility and long term reliability. Andy explains why fusible HDPE is widely used for underground chilled water, process water, wastewater and conduit applications. Inside facilities, PPR-CT is gaining traction where higher operating temperatures and dimensional stability are required. Key drivers include corrosion resistance, system cleanliness, reduced weight and hydraulic performance.

    The episode highlights the scale of modern data center development and its impact on pipe volume, prefabrication and quality control. Andy discusses automated fusion using McElroy equipment, including the Acrobat I Series, ProFab 400i and the McElroy Datalogger, used to document fusion parameters and support consistent joint quality.

    As hyperscalers continue deploying HDPE and PPR-CT, adoption is extending beyond private development and into municipal systems. Proven performance is building confidence among engineers, contractors and utilities and accelerating broader use of fusible piping across water and utility infrastructure.
